Essential Strategies on How to Extend the Life of Your Tile Roof in New Braunfels

Understanding Tile Roof Lifespan & Why New Braunfels Weather Demands Extra Care

Tile roofs are known for exceptional durability, often lasting 40–75+ years, but that doesn’t happen automatically—especially not in a climate like New Braunfels, Texas. Many homeowners mistakenly assume tile roofs are “maintenance-free,” but the truth is that tile roofs require strategic upkeep, regular inspections, and timely repairs if you want them to reach their full lifespan.

In New Braunfels, tile roofs face harsher conditions compared to average U.S. homes. Extreme sunlight, sudden thunderstorms, hail, humidity swings, and debris impact all contribute to faster deterioration of underlayment, flashing, and structural components. While the tiles themselves may last decades, the components beneath them often fail sooner, creating leaks long before the homeowner notices a visible problem.

This comprehensive guide explains the strategies every New Braunfels homeowner should follow to protect their tile roof, prevent premature damage, and ensure maximum performance and longevity.

Why Tile Roof Lifespan Is Different in New Braunfels

Tile roofs are one of the strongest roofing systems available, but Texas weather is uniquely aggressive. According to the NOAA Storm Events Database, Comal County regularly experiences:

  • Hail storms
  • High-speed winds
  • Heatwaves
  • Sudden heavy rainfall
  • Winter moisture cycles

Each of these environmental factors attacks tile roofs from different angles.

Extreme Texas Heat Weakens Underlayment

Tile surfaces can reach 160–180°F in the summer. While tiles handle heat well, the underlayment beneath them does not. NREL studies prove that prolonged heat weakens traditional felt underlayment by 30–40%, causing early tears, cracking, and UV breakdown.

Windstorms Dislodge Tiles

Strong winds typical in New Braunfels lift tiles, break mortar bonds, and shift ridge caps. Even a slight shift allows water to penetrate beneath the tile system.

Hail Impact Creates Invisible Cracks

Tile roofs resist impact better than shingles, but hail can still cause:

  • Hairline cracks
  • Fractured edges
  • Pressure bruising
  • Broken ridge tiles

Most hail damage is not visible from the ground.

What Actually Determines Tile Roof Lifespan

Contrary to popular belief, the tiles themselves rarely determine roof lifespan. What matters most are:

1. Underlayment Quality

Synthetic underlayment lasts 3–5x longer than traditional felt.

2. Flashing Durability

Poorly installed flashing causes 70–80% of leaks (NRCA).

3. Roof Ventilation

Proper ventilation reduces heat pressure and moisture buildup.

4. Maintenance Frequency

Annual inspections prevent small issues from becoming major ones.

5. Storm Response Time

Tile roofs need inspection after every major storm.

Common Tile Roof Problems in New Braunfels

Tile roofs look incredibly strong from the outside, but many issues occur beneath the surface.

Cracked or Broken Tiles

Caused by hail, fallen branches, or foot traffic.

Slipped Tiles

Windstorms loosen tile alignment.

Underlayment Failure

The #1 cause of leaks in tile roofs.

Flashing Separation

Often occurs around chimneys, skylights, and walls.

Valley Blockage

Storm debris accumulates in valley channels.

Deck Deterioration

Long-term moisture exposure rots wood decking.

These problems must be addressed early to extend roof lifespan.

How Professionals Repair Tile Roofs in New Braunfels

Tile roofs cannot be repaired the same way as shingle or metal roofs. Because of the tile locking system, weight distribution, and underlayment structure, only trained tile specialists should handle repairs.

Below are the techniques professionals use to ensure long-term performance and avoid additional damage.

1. Replacing Cracked or Broken Tiles Correctly

Broken tiles may look harmless, but even tiny fractures allow UV exposure, moisture penetration, and internal dampness that weakens the underlayment.
According to FEMA roofing assessments, cracks caused by hail or impact must be replaced immediately to prevent hidden moisture damage.

Professional Replacement Steps Include:

  • Carefully lifting the overlapping tiles
  • Removing the cracked tile without damaging surrounding pieces
  • Inspecting the underlayment for UV exposure
  • Replacing the tile with the exact matching profile
  • Securing it with proper fasteners or hooks
  • Re-aligning the tile rows for drainage efficiency

2. Fixing Slipped, Shifted, or Loose Tiles

Strong winds in New Braunfels often shift tile rows—especially at eaves, ridges, and valleys.
A single shifted tile disrupts water channels, forcing rain underneath the tile system.

Professionals repair tile shifting by:

  • Resetting tiles into proper alignment
  • Reinforcing battens
  • Securing the tile using storm-rated clips
  • Checking valley metal edges for water intrusion

3. Repairing Ridge and Hip Tiles

Ridge and hip tiles take the brunt of wind and debris impact. Mortar used in older roofs often erodes, leading to loose ridge caps.

Professional repairs involve:

  • Removing damaged ridge tiles
  • Inspecting mortar bedding
  • Applying fresh structural mortar or mechanical fasteners
  • Resetting the ridge cap tiles securely

Loose ridge caps are one of the top causes of leaks during New Braunfels storms.

4. Rebuilding Valleys for Improved Water Drainage

Tile roof valleys are high-flow areas. New Braunfels storms dump large amounts of water at once, and valleys must channel it efficiently.

Experts inspect for:

  • Clogged debris
  • Rusted valley metal
  • Improper overlap
  • Loose valley tiles

Repairs may include:

  • Cleaning the entire valley
  • Installing new valley flashing
  • Re-aligning valley tiles for optimal flow

Tile valley restoration enhances performance during flash storms.

Underlayment Protection — The Most Important Factor in Roof Longevity

Your tile roof’s beauty and durability mean nothing if the underlayment fails. The underlayment (the waterproof layer beneath the tiles) is the true protector of your home.

In New Braunfels, heat + humidity + storms cause underlayment to deteriorate much faster than expected.
NREL studies show underlayment ages 2–3 times faster in high-heat climates.

When Underlayment Must Be Replaced

Underlayment typically needs replacement every:

  • 20–30 years for felt underlayment
  • 35–50 years for synthetic underlayment

Signs of underlayment failure:

  • Attic moisture
  • Wet insulation
  • Ceiling stains
  • Mold smell
  • Visible cracks under removed tiles
  • Warped decking

Flashing: The Primary Source of Tile Roof Leaks

According to the National Roofing Contractors Association (NRCA), over 80% of roof leaks occur at flashing points, not the tiles themselves.

Common flashing failure points include:

  • Chimneys
  • Skylights
  • Roof-to-wall intersections
  • Vent penetrations
  • Valleys

Professional flashing repair includes:

  • Removing surrounding tiles
  • Replacing rusted flashing
  • Installing upgraded storm-rated metal
  • Reapplying waterproof sealant
  • Re-aligning tiles over flashing

The Importance of Proper Tile Roof Cleaning

Tile roofs require soft-washing, not pressure washing.

Why pressure washing is dangerous:

  • Breaks tiles
  • Strips surface coating
  • Forces water under tiles
  • Damages underlayment
  • Creates leaks

Soft-washing uses:

  • Low-pressure water
  • Algae remover
  • Mild biodegradable solutions

This method protects the structural integrity of tiles.

Complete Exterior Tile Roof Inspection Steps

A professional tile roof inspection includes the following:

1. Surface Tile Examination

Roofers examine:

  • Cracks
  • Hairline fractures
  • Broken edges
  • Displaced tiles
  • Pressure marks from hail
  • Erosion patterns
  • UV fading

Tiles that appear intact from a distance may have micro-cracks that allow water beneath them.

2. Checking for Slipped or Lifted Tiles

New Braunfels windstorms commonly shift tiles, especially near:

  • Ridges
  • Hip lines
  • Eaves
  • Valleys

Moved tiles expose the underlayment to water and UV damage. Even a 1-inch shift disrupts water flow and increases leak risk.

3. Inspecting Valleys & Water Flow Channels

Tile roof valleys are the highest-stress areas. Roofers check for:

  • Debris blockages
  • Loose valley tiles
  • Corroded valley metal
  • Improper tile overlap
  • Water pooling
  • Flashing damage

Valley issues cause leaks long before homeowners notice surface damage.

4. Chimney, Skylight & Wall Flashing

NRCA reports that over 80% of tile roof leaks occur due to flashing issues, not tile defects.
Roofers inspect:

  • Rust
  • Sealant gaps
  • Metal lifting
  • Loose mortar
  • Flashing movement after storms
  • Improper tile seating around flashing

Flashing repairs often require custom metal fabrication.

Interior (Attic) Inspection — The True Indicator of Roof Health

Even if the exterior looks perfect, the attic reveals hidden issues.
Experts inspect for:

  • Water stains
  • Damp insulation
  • Mold odor
  • Visible drips
  • Decking rot
  • Rusted nails
  • Light penetration
  • Soft or spongy wood

Tile roofs leak underneath the tiles long before water reaches interior ceilings.

Seasonal Tile Roof Care Schedule for New Braunfels Homeowners

Different seasons affect tile roofs in different ways. A proper 12-month care cycle extends your roof’s life and prevents hidden deterioration.

Early Spring — Post-Winter Inspection & Cleaning

Winter moisture settles in underlayment layers and can weaken battens or flashing. In New Braunfels, early spring temperatures also trigger algae growth.

Your spring checklist should include:

  • Inspecting for cracked or loose tiles
  • Checking for water stains inside the attic
  • Clearing branches and winter debris
  • Examining valleys for blockages
  • Soft-washing any moss or algae-starting areas

Summer — Heat Protection & Underlayment Preservation

Summer is the most damaging season for tile roofs due to high UV exposure. NREL research shows that underlayment deterioration accelerates significantly in extreme heat, especially under concrete or clay tiles.

Summer care includes:

  • Ensuring proper attic ventilation
  • Checking for slipped tiles caused by thermal expansion
  • Inspecting ridge and hip tiles
  • Looking for cracking in older tiles
  • Monitoring indoor humidity

Ventilation optimization can also reduce electricity bills by improving cooling efficiency.

Fall — Preparing for Rain & Temperature Drops

During fall, New Braunfels receives increased rainfall and falling leaves, which clog gutters and block valleys.

Your fall maintenance checklist:

  • Clean gutters thoroughly
  • Install gutter guards (prevents tile-edge saturation)
  • Remove all branches, leaves, and roof debris
  • Inspect eaves and tile overhangs
  • Seal any small flashing gaps
  • Inspect underlayment if any tiles have been displaced

Winter — Moisture Prevention & Tile Surface Protection

Tile roofs generally withstand winter well, but moisture is the greatest threat. Water trapped beneath tiles during cold nights can damage decking or underlayment.

Winter protection steps:

  • Inspect tiles after freeze–thaw episodes
  • Ensure no cracked tiles allow water penetration
  • Check attic insulation to prevent condensation
  • Remove any standing debris water can freeze under

Bird-Stop Installation

Clay and concrete tiles create natural openings at eaves. Birds and rodents often enter these gaps, damaging the underlayment and insulation.

Bird-stops seal these openings and extend underlayment life.

1. How long does a tile roof last in New Braunfels?

Concrete and clay tile roofs typically last 40–70 years, depending on maintenance and underlayment quality.

2. Does heat affect tile roof lifespan?

Yes. Extreme heat accelerates underlayment deterioration. New Braunfels’ hot climate requires regular inspection and ventilation checks.

3. Should I pressure wash a tile roof?

No. Pressure washing cracks tiles and forces water underneath. Only soft-washing should be used.

4. How often should tile roofs be inspected?

At least once per year, plus after major storms.

5. Can a tile roof leak even if tiles look perfect?

Yes. Most leaks come from underlayment failure, not tile cracks.

6. How long does underlayment last?

  • Traditional felt: 20–30 years
  • Synthetic underlayment: 35–50 years

7. What causes tile roof leaks the most?

According to NRCA, over 80% of leaks occur at flashing, not tiles.

8. Are tile roofs good for storms?

Yes—when properly fastened and reinforced. Tile roofs are great for wind and hail but need stable flashing and ridge caps.

9. Can tile roofs be repaired easily?

Yes, but only by a tile roofing professional. Incorrect tile lifting causes more damage.

10. Do insurance companies cover tile roof damage?

Yes. Hail, wind, and impact damage are often covered. Using NOAA storm reports strengthens claims.

11. Should I replace my tile roof or only the underlayment?

Most tile roofs only require underlayment replacement, not full tile replacement.

12. Can mold grow under tile roofs?

Yes. Moisture under tiles can lead to mold in decking or insulation.
